A food stamp office is a government agency that provides food assistance to low-income individuals and families. The Food Stamp Program, also known as the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P), is a federal program that helps people buy the food they need for good health. In Etown, Kentucky, the local food stamp office is located at 1004 North Dixie Highway.
SNAP is an important program that helps to reduce hunger and food insecurity in the United States. In 2020, SNAP lifted 3.1 million people out of poverty, including 1.2 million children. The program also has a positive impact on the economy, generating $1.80 in economic activity for every $1 invested.
